Considering Your French Visa Requirements and Eligibility
Before embarking on your journey to France, it's essential to grasp the visa requirements and eligibility criteria. The specific requirements you'll need will depend on the purpose of your trip, such as tourism, study, or work.
A current copyright with at least six months of validity remaining is a primary requirement for all visa applicants. You'll also require to submit a completed copyright form along with recent photographs that adhere the specified guidelines. To demonstrate your monetary stability, you may need to provide evidence of sufficient funds to cover your expenses during your stay in France.
Moreover, you'll likely require to provide travel insurance that satisfies French regulations.
Depending the nature of your trip, you may also need to present additional documents, such as a letter of invitation, proof of accommodation, or a study acceptance letter.
It's strongly recommended that you start your copyright process well in advance of your planned travel dates.
